An improved binaural hearing model is proposed that consists of a physiologically motivated signal processing step and a subsequent cognitive model. The model is shown to be capable of correctly detecting and tracking sources while blindly determining the number of active sources based on temporal and spectral information.
The complete model is of interest in all areas that need to consider the capabilities of the human hearing system while the ability to determine the number of active sources makes it a logical enhancement of many source separation algorithms that rely on this knowledge.
